TASUKE+: a web-based platform for exploring GWAS results and large-scale resequencing data

Abstract: Recent revolutionary advancements in sequencing technologies have made it possible to obtain mass quantities of genome-scale sequence data in a cost-effective manner and have drastically altered molecular biological studies. To utilize these sequence data, genome-wide association studies (GWASs) have become increasingly important. Hence, there is an urgent need to develop a visualization tool that enables efficient data retrieval, integration of GWAS results with diverse information and rapid public release of… Show more

“…‘Takanari’ has A-type in the G / A polymorphism and TT-type in the GC / TT polymorphism of the Alk gene based on genotyping by the DNA marker of Bao et al ( 2006 ) and Hiratsuka et al ( 2010 ). It was different with other weak functional alleles of the japonica -type alk ( Alk a ) in ‘Koshihikari’, Alk ( Alk c ) in typical indica type and Alk b in the previous study (Chen et al 2020 ), but the same weak functional allele as other japonica rice cultivars such as ‘Asahi’ and ‘Akebono’ according to the RAP-DB and Rice-TASUKE database ( https://ricegenomes.dna.affrc.go.jp/ , Sakai et al 2013 ; Kawahara et al 2013 ; Kumagai et al 2019 ). Therefore, ‘Koshihikari’ and ‘Takanari’ have the two weak functional alleles of both the Wx and Alk genes.…”

“…Here, we detected one eating quality QTL, qST3–1 , also on the short arm of chromosome 3, and the ‘Koshihikari’ allele of this QTL was also associated with high eating quality score and strong stickiness of cooked grains. The ‘Takanari’ allele of qOE3 would be the same as the ‘Nipponbare’ allele because of consistent haplotypes between these cultivars according to the RAP-DB and TASUKE databases (Sakai et al 2013 ; Kawahara et al 2013 ; Kumagai et al 2019 ). Therefore, qST3–1 is likely identical to qOE3 .…”
